    There is a DS game from Japan that was like this, full of anime characters, Jump Super Stars, that was fantastic. I kind of hate anime, though, so I never knew who was who or what their powers were supposed to be. It was never released outside Japan due to copyright issues, but it still had an English fan translation to make it playable.
